Subject: Re: [RFC PATCH v5 13/14] media: tegra-video: Add CSI MIPI pads calibration
Date: Tue, 28 Jul 2020 08:59:46 -0700	[thread overview]
Message-ID: <01ee0805-3d57-d857-48e3-5c2245cd4500@nvidia.com> (raw)
In-Reply-To: <c3d40261-9d77-3634-3e04-f20efad9d3d8@gmail.com>


On 7/28/20 3:30 AM, Dmitry Osipenko wrote:
> 27.07.2020 23:57, Sowjanya Komatineni пишет:
>> +	/*
>> +	 * TRM has incorrectly documented to wait for done status from
>> +	 * calibration logic after CSI interface power on.
>> +	 * As per the design, calibration results are latched and applied
>> +	 * to the pads only when the link is in LP11 state which will happen
>> +	 * during the sensor stream-on.
>> +	 * CSI subdev stream-on triggers start of MIPI pads calibration.
>> +	 * Wait for calibration to finish here after sensor subdev stream-on
>> +	 * and in case of sensor stream-on failure, cancel the calibration.
>> +	 */
>>   	subdev = on ? src_subdev : csi_subdev;
>>   	ret = v4l2_subdev_call(subdev, video, s_stream, on);
>> -	if (ret < 0 && ret != -ENOIOCTLCMD)
>> +	if (ret < 0 && ret != -ENOIOCTLCMD) {
> I assume -ENOIOCTLCMD means that camera wasn't turned ON, so why
> -ENOIOCTLCMD is special?
No -ENOIOCTLCMD mean subdev don't have s_stream ops
>
>> +		if (on && csi_chan->mipi)
>> +			tegra_mipi_cancel_calibration(csi_chan->mipi);
>>   		return ret;
>> +	}
>> +
>> +	if (on && csi_chan->mipi) {
> Does finish_calibration() really need to be called for ret=-ENOIOCTLCMD?
>
> Shouldn't it be cancel_calibration( for the -ENOIOCTLCMD?

start calibration happens during csi sensor streaming which happens 
prior to this point.

In case if sensor subdev does not have s_stream ops, then either 
finish/cancel calibration should happen to disable the clock.

>
>> +		ret = tegra_mipi_finish_calibration(csi_chan->mipi);
>> +		if (ret < 0)
>> +			dev_err(csi_chan->csi->dev,
>> +				"MIPI calibration failed: %d\n", ret);
> Doesn't v4l2_subdev_call(OFF) need to be invoked here on error?

Not required as on error streaming fails and runtime PM will turn off 
power anyway.

Also we only did csi subdev s_stream on and during sensor subdev 
s_stream on fail, actual stream dont happen and on tegra side frame 
capture by HW happens only when kthreads run.
>> +		return ret;
>> +	}
>>   
>>   	return 0;
>>   }
